Ring Wired Video Doorbell Pro (3rd Gen) Not Detecting Motion

🔄 Try this first — Switch off the power to the doorbell at the consumer unit for 10 seconds, then switch it back on. Also restart your router by unplugging for 30 seconds.

Is your Ring Wired Video Doorbell Pro (3rd Gen) failing to detect motion or trigger alerts when someone approaches? Here are the checks you can safely carry out before contacting support.

What This Problem Means

The doorbell is powered and connected but its 3D Motion Detection is not triggering recordings or sending notifications. This is most commonly caused by motion zone settings, sensitivity configuration or the radar-powered 3D detection needing recalibration.

Common Symptoms

  • People and vehicles approach without any motion alert or recording being triggered
  • Ring event history shows few or no recent motion events
  • Motion alerts stopped after a Ring app update or settings change
  • Alerts are received by other household members but not on your device

Safe Checks You Can Try

1. Check Motion Sensitivity and Zones

Open the Ring app, go to your doorbell’s Motion Settings and review both sensitivity and motion zones. The 3D Motion Detection on the Wired Video Doorbell Pro (3rd Gen) is radar-powered and uses configurable zones. Ensure zones are drawn to cover the area where you expect activity, and increase sensitivity if needed.

2. Check 3D Motion Detection Is Enabled

In the Ring app go to Motion Settings and confirm 3D Motion Detection is active. If it has been switched to standard motion detection only, the radar-powered precision will not be in use and detection may be less reliable.

3. Check Smart Alerts Settings

If Smart Alerts are enabled, the doorbell may be filtering certain motion types. Go to Motion Settings → Smart Alerts and confirm all relevant categories (People, Vehicles, Other Motion) are switched on.

4. Check Notification Settings on Your Phone

Open the Ring app and confirm Motion Alerts are not snoozed. Then check your phone’s system notification settings to ensure the Ring app has permission to send alerts. Do Not Disturb and Focus modes can also block notifications.

5. Check Ring Protect Subscription

Without an active Ring Protect plan, video recording for motion events may be limited. Check your subscription status in the Ring app under Account.
